Azure SRE 에이전트에서 기술 문서 업로드

팁 (조언)

  • 대리인은 수동적인 파일 관리 없이 대화 중 런북을 생성하고 업로드합니다.
  • 즉각적인 분석 컨텍스트를 위해 채팅에서 31가지 파일 형식(예.kql: , .bicep.tf, .har.py.xlsx)을 첨부합니다.
  • 향후의 모든 대화에서 인덱싱된 영구 스토리지를 위해 지식 설정에 28개의 파일 형식 업로드
  • 인시던트 해결은 자동으로 제도적 지식이 됩니다.

문제: 대화로 지식이 죽는다

팀이 해결하는 모든 인시던트에는 무엇이 잘못되었는지, 어떤 명령이 수정되었는지, 다음에 먼저 확인해야 할 사항과 같은 중요한 지식이 생성됩니다. 그러나 그 지식은 채팅 스레드, 엔지니어의 기억, 그리고 아무도 오전 3시에 읽지 않는 사후 분석에 존재합니다.

팀에는 운영 절차서가 있지만, 그것들이 낡았습니다. 어젯밤 사건 중에 발견 된 수정 사항? 누군가의 머릿속에 남아 있거나, 다음 주면 화면 밖으로 사라져 버릴 대화 속에 묻혀 있을 뿐이다. 다음에 동일한 문제가 발생할 때 다른 엔지니어가 처음부터 시작합니다.

에이전트가 이 문제를 해결하는 방법

에이전트는 기술 문서 업로드 도구를 사용하여 대화 중에 기술 자료 설정에 문서를 업로드 할 수 있습니다. 에이전트가 수정 사항을 검색하거나, 문제 해결 가이드를 만들거나, 조사 결과를 합성하면 해당 지식을 직접 저장하고 향후 모든 대화에서 검색할 수 있습니다.

"Create a runbook from the steps we just followed to fix this database
connection pool exhaustion issue and save it to Knowledge settings."

에이전트가 구조화된 런북을 생성한 후 몇 초 안에 업로드합니다. 문서는 자동으로 인덱싱되며 향후 조사를 검색할 수 있게 됩니다.

이전 및 이후

이전 이후
지식 캡처 인시던트 후: 엔지니어가 Runbook을 작성합니다(어쩌면) 에이전트가 수정 사항이 발생하는 즉시 캡처합니다.
문서화 시간 Runbook을 작성하는 데 30~60분 초. 에이전트가 직접 생성하여 업로드합니다.
지식 새로 고침 Runbook은 몇 주 안에 부실해집니다. 문제를 해결할 때마다 지식이 더욱 향상됩니다.
접근성 엔지니어의 머리 또는 채팅 스레드에 갇힌 지식 향후 모든 대화에서 에이전트가 검색할 수 있습니다.
형식 일관성 작성자별로 다름 매번 구조화되고 일관된 설명서

이것이 다른 이유

수동 업로드와 달리 에이전트는 사전에 지식을 만듭니다. 에이전트가 대화의 일부로 수행하므로 배운 내용을 문서화할 필요가 없습니다.

채팅 기록과 달리 업로드된 문서는 의미 체계 검색을 위해 인덱싱됩니다. 몇 달 후에 비슷한 문제가 발생하면 에이전트는 이전 스레드를 스크롤하는 대신, 지능형 검색 기능을 통해 자동으로 관련 런북을 찾아냅니다.

위키 커넥터와 달리 업로드된 문서에는 외부 서비스가 필요하지 않습니다. 지식은 에이전트의 지식 설정에 직접 저장되며, 동기화 지연 없이 즉시 사용할 수 있습니다.

작동 방식

기술 문서 업로드 도구는 다음 세 가지 매개 변수를 허용합니다.

매개 변수 필수 설명
파일 이름 .md 또는 .txt 확장명을 포함한 이름(예시: database-pool-runbook.md)
Content Markdown 또는 일반 텍스트 형식의 전체 문서 텍스트
인덱싱 시작 선택 사항(기본값: true) 문서를 즉시 검색할 수 있도록 할지 여부

에이전트가 문서를 업로드하는 경우:

  1. 파일 이름 및 콘텐츠의 유효성을 검사합니다(파일당 최대 16MB).
  2. 에이전트의 기술 자료 설정에 문서를 저장합니다.
  3. 의미 체계 검색을 위해 콘텐츠를 인덱싱합니다.
  4. 성공 메시지를 사용하여 업로드를 확인합니다.

메모

동일한 파일 이름을 가진 문서가 이미 있는 경우 새 콘텐츠가 대체됩니다. 이 프로세스를 통해 에이전트가 지식을 쉽게 업데이트할 수 있습니다. 동일한 이름으로 업로드하여 콘텐츠를 새로 고칩니다.

지원되는 파일 형식

에이전트는 각각 다른 형식을 지원하는 세 가지 방법을 통해 파일을 처리합니다.

채팅 첨부 파일

에이전트가 즉각적으로 분석할 수 있는 컨텍스트를 제공하기 위해 문제 해결 스크립트, 구성 파일, 네트워크 추적 파일 등을 포함한 파일을 대화창에 끌어다 놓으세요.

카테고리 Extensions
Images .png, .jpg, .jpeg, .gif, .webp.svg
Documents .txt, .md, .pdf, .docx, .pptx.xlsx
데이터 및 구성 .json,.csv, .log, .yaml, .yml, .xml.ini, .conf.env
웹 및 네트워크 .html, .har
코드 및 스크립트 .ts, .js, .py, .sh, .sql.kql
인프라 .bicep, .tf

제한: 파일당 10MB · 메시지당 총 50MB · 메시지당 5개 파일

지식 설정 업로드

에이전트가 향후 대화에서 참조할 문서를 유지하려면 작성기 → 기술 설정 → 파일 추가를 통해 파일을 업로드합니다. 시스템은 의미 체계 검색을 위해 업로드된 파일을 인덱싱합니다.

카테고리 Extensions
Images .png, .jpg, .jpeg, .gif, .webp, .bmp, .tiff.tif
Documents .txt,.md, .pdf, .docx, .pptx, .xlsx.doc, .ppt.xls
데이터 및 구성 .json, .csv, .log, .yaml, .yml, .xml, .ini, .conf.cfg, .config.properties

제한: 파일당 16MB · 업로드당 100MB

폴더 업로드

지원되는 모든 파일을 한 번에 업로드하려면 전체 폴더를 업로드 드롭 영역으로 끌어다 놓습니다. 이 프로세스에는 중첩된 하위 폴더의 파일이 포함됩니다. 포털은 폴더 계층 구조에서 모든 파일을 자동으로 추출하고 지원되지 않는 파일 형식을 필터링합니다.

폴더 업로드 작동 방법:

  1. 시스템은 중첩된 하위 폴더에서 플랫 목록으로 모든 파일을 추출합니다.
  2. 시스템은 지원되는 확장이 있는 파일만 포함하고 지원되지 않는 형식을 자동으로 필터링합니다.
  3. 시스템은 다른 하위 폴더의 중복된 이름으로 파일을 중복 제거하고 첫 번째 파일만 유지합니다.
  4. 시스템은 검색을 위해 각 파일을 개별적으로 업로드하고 인덱싱합니다.

메모

업로드된 파일은 기술 자료의 개별 문서로 표시됩니다. 원래 폴더 계층 구조는 유지 관리되지 않습니다. 파일은 runbooks/networking/dns-troubleshooting.md 위치에서 dns-troubleshooting.md처럼 표시됩니다.

지식 설정 업로드는 채팅 첨부 파일이 허용하지 않는 레거시 Office 형식(.doc, .ppt, .xls) 및 추가 이미지 형식(.bmp, .tiff, .tif)을 허용합니다. 채팅 첨부 파일은 지식 설정에서 지원하지 않는 코드, 스크립트, 인프라 및 웹 형식을 지원합니다.

에이전트에서 생성된 문서

에이전트가 대화 중에 문서를 만들 때( 기술 문서 업로드 도구를 사용하여) 문서를 생성 .md 하거나 .txt 파일을 만들어 지식 설정에 직접 저장합니다. 이 프로세스는 에이전트에 "Runbook으로 저장"하도록 요청할 때 발생합니다.

예시: 사건 관련 지식 수집

인시던트 조사 중에 에이전트에게 다음을 요청합니다.

We just resolved the high CPU issue on web-app-prod. It was caused by a
memory leak in the connection pool. Create a troubleshooting guide from
what we learned and upload it to Knowledge settings.

에이전트는 다음을 사용하여 구조화된 문제 해결 가이드를 생성합니다.

  • 스코핑 단계: 문제를 파악하는 방법
  • 빠른 완화: 영향을 줄이기 위한 즉각적인 작업입니다.
  • 근본 원인 분석: 조사할 내용.
  • 해결 단계: 작동된 수정 사항입니다.
  • 방지: 되풀이를 방지하는 방법입니다.

다음에 비슷한 CPU 문제가 발생할 때 에이전트는 조사 중에 이 문서를 자동으로 참조하여 한 엔지니어의 경험을 공유 팀 지식으로 전환합니다.

필요한 항목

요구 사항 세부 정보
에이전트 버전 26.1.57.0 이상
지식 설정 에이전트에서 활성화됨
쓰기 권한 에이전트가 지식 설정에 대한 쓰기 액세스 권한이 필요합니다.
실행 모드 검토 또는 자율. 쓰기 작업에는 검토 모드에서 승인이 필요합니다.

제한

특성 채팅 첨부 파일 지식 설정 업로드 에이전트 도구
최대 파일 크기 10MB 16MB 16MB
최대 합계 메시지당 50MB 업로드당 100MB N/A
최대 파일 메시지당 5개 제한 없음(총 크기는 100MB로 제한됨) 작업당 1
폴더 업로드 지원되지 않음 ✓ 폴더를 끌어서 한 번에 모든 파일 업로드 지원되지 않음
지원되는 확장 31 28 2 (.md, .txt)
파일 이름 문자 N/A 문자, 숫자, 하이픈, 밑줄, 점 동일
최대 파일 이름 길이 N/A 1,024자 동일

다른 항목을 사용하는 경우

시나리오 더 나은 접근 방식
동기화 상태로 유지되는 라이브 위키 콘텐츠 연결 ADO Wiki 지식
이진 파일 업로드(PDF, Word, 이미지) 작성기 → 기술 설정 → 파일 추가를 통해 업로드
여러 문서를 한 번에 대량으로 가져오기 작성기 → 기술 정보 설정을 통해 여러 파일 업로드 → 파일 추가
코드 리포지토리를 자동으로 최신 상태로 유지 GitHub 또는 ADO 커넥터 연결
역량 추가되는 내용
ADO 위키 지식 자동으로 업데이트되는 라이브 위키 콘텐츠 연결
근본 원인 분석 문제 조사 및 결과 캡처